About Ben Marshall
Ben Marshall was born in Marshall, MI in 1978. He began playing guitar at the young age of 12 where he studied under Guitarist George Yeatman (Professor at Baltimore and Florida Universities). Ben experimented with many different styles of music, ranging from classical, jazz, pop, folk, Alt. Rock and blues. At the age of 19, Ben attended college in Grand Rapids, MI where his friend introduced him to artists such as Nick Drake, Elliott Smith and Jeff Buckley. Listening to these artists opened a whole new world for Ben. It was at this point that he decided to pursue a career in music. He began playing with local musicians and developed a strong following. In the winter of 2001, Ben began to work on songs for his first solo project entitled Things Left Behind. About a month later, Ben was introduced to local producer/engineer/artist/ Mopic Vagma. Mopic and Ben spent the next three months recording and producing Things Left Behind at Freezing Studios in Grand Rapids. This project received airtime on many independent stations including WYCE and was reviewed by the Grand Rapids Free Press. The Free Press stated, Bens sound is reminiscent of Simon/Garfunkel, Elliott Smith, and Nick Drake, we look forward to hearing more out of this young talent. Currently Ben is performing at local Detroit venues such as The Arch, Xhedos, Smalls, Jacobys, Detroit Taste Festival, Michigan State Fair, The Charlie Stop, Trixies, Wise Fools Pub, The Belmont, The 5th Avenue and the Magic Bag Theater to name a few. He is currently in the process of completing his First full-length album entitled "Songs for Everyone" with the assistance of drummer Jeff Cox and engineer Alec Houston. This album will be a compilation of new material and re-produced songs from "Things Left Behind". Ben is now promoting himself as an independent artist in the hopes of developing his songs and fan base to spread his music throughout the world. His new album titled "Songs for Everyone" will be released in 2007. Ben will be performing live with drummer Jeff cox upon completion of the album.
